DOWNTOWN LOS ANGELES — Downtowners with little ones should take note of a pair of Easter offerings taking place this weekend. On Saturday and Sunday, Pershing Square and New City Church back to back days of holiday-themed events.
Pershing Square's "Eggstravaganza" Egg Hunt takes place on Saturday, April 11. It features arts & crafts, music, magic, storytelling and the always-popular inflatables from 11am to 4pm. Egg hunting times are divided up by age. Kids ages 5 and under get their turn at 11:30am, followed by ages 5 - 7 at 12:30pm, 8 - 10 at 1:30pm and finally kids 11 - 12 at 2:30pm.

On Sunday, New City Church offers "Easter Fest for Kids" from 10am - 3pm. Kids and adults are invited to a brunch at 10am, with kids attending NewCityKidz! during the service. Afterward, there will be an Easter egg hunt and much more in the New LATC lobby from noon to 3pm.
